Written Answers — Turbary Rights: Turbary Rights (17 May 2005)

Dick Roche: In July 2004 my Department concluded an agreement with the farming pillar under Sustaining Progress which involved increased rates of compensation for the cessation of turf cutting in bogs that have been proposed as designated conservation areas. This agreement incorporates retrospective provisions benefiting landowners who participated in the original 1999 scheme for disposal of raised bogs...

Written Answers — Water and Sewerage Schemes: Water and Sewerage Schemes (17 May 2005)

Dick Roche: The Castleisland sewerage scheme, stage 2, is included in my Department's water services investment programme 2004-2006 as a scheme to commence construction in 2006 at an estimated cost of €5.5 million. My Department received the required water charging policy report for the scheme from Kerry County Council within the past few days. This will allow consideration of the council's preliminary...

Written Answers — Hazardous Substances: Hazardous Substances (17 May 2005)

Dick Roche: Asbestos cement piping complying with the specifications of Irish Standard 188 which, inter alia, requires bitumen lining and coating, was widely used in the provision of new local authority water mains for more than 30 years. It has also been extensively used and is a well-established and accepted product for this purpose, internationally. The main health risk associated with asbestos...

Written Answers — Waste Management: Waste Management (17 May 2005)

Dick Roche: The making of waste service charges is a matter for individual local authorities engaged in the direct provision of waste collection services and for private providers of such services. Similarly, the type of pay-by-use system used is principally a matter for service providers, having regard to Government policy.
